Lists of loose leaf teas.

Hi there, I went to the store to buy some more teas for remedies, powders and wards and here and there tricks.
I figured I would give a list of teas that will help the mind and body, instead of trying to brew a magic powder for transfiguration. So! Here's a few of my favorite teas that anyone can live by!

White Teas:
  • -Most Antioxidants 
  • -Great for Skin
  • -May prevent cancer

-Silver Needle - Steep in 175F water for 4-5 mins.
-Flavored White - Steep in 175F for 1-2 mins.
-White Ayurvedic Chai - Steep in 175F for 2 mins.
-Silver Yin Zhen Pearls - Steep in 175F for 4-5 mins.

Green Teas:
  • Helps prevent cancer.
  • Boosts immune system.
  • Regulates blood sugar levels.
-Jasmine Dragon Phoenix Pearls - Steep at 175F for 2 mins.
-Huang Shan Mao Feng Reserve - Steep 175F for 1 min.
-Gyokuro Imperial - Steep at 175F for 30 - 45 sec.

    Oolong Teas:
    • Good for your stomach.
    • Speeds up metabolism and aids in weight loss.
    • Good for skin and teeth.
    -Jasmine Oolong - Steep at 195F for 3 mins.
    -Eastern Beauty - Steep at 195F for 3 mins.
    -Dan Cong - Steep at 195F for 3 mins.
    -Monkey Picked Oolong - Steep for 195F for 3 mins.

    Black Teas:

    • Prevents heart disease and strokes.
    • Good for lowering blood pressure and cholesterol.
    -Ying Ming Yunnan
    -Earl Grey
    -Kangaroo Lapsang

    Mate Teas:

    • 100% caffeinated bush.
    • Curbs appetite.
    • 21vitamins and minerals.
    -Yerba Mate.


    Rooibos Teas:

    • Red bush from South Africa.
    • Aids in digestion.
    • Aids in combating allergies.
    • A lot of vitamins.


    Herbal Teas:
    • Fruity infused contains hibiscus and rosehips which is very good for the immune system and contains vitamin C. 
    • The dried fruits contains antioxidants, and ginger is good for the stomach.
    -Anything really, from Strawberry lemonade to my favorite Raspberry riot and Apple, Lemon, Pomegranate.
